Wells Insurance Unit Picks Finance Officer

Wells Fargo Insurance Services Inc., a unit of Wells Fargo & Co., has named Todd Wartchow senior finance officer.

Working from Chicago, will direct financial performance and the development of strategic business initiatives. He will also manage finance team members in the preparation of profitability analyses of products, customers and/or business segments and potential new lines of business and acquisitions.

Wartchow is also in charge of developing and maintaining the governance and control structure of Wells Fargo Insurance Services.

Before joining Wells Fargo Insurance Services, Wartchow was a senior vice president and head of the financial management team for Wells Fargo's Los Angeles Metro Community Bank, where he managed nearly 300 branches in Los Angeles, Ventura and Santa Barbara counties.

Wells Fargo Insurance Services along with Wachovia Insurance Services is the fifth-largest insurance brokerage company in the world and the largest bank-owned insurance brokerage firm in the U.S.

The appointment was announced Tuesday.
